安装:Markdown
使用:在admin注册表
添加语法等:
# 一、段落
在想要设置为标题的文字前面加#来表示
一个#是一级标题,二个#是二级标题,以此类推。支持六级标题。
注:标准语法一般在#后跟个空格再写文字,貌似简书不加空格也行
# 二、字体
**这是加粗的文字**
*这是倾斜的文字*`
***这是斜体加粗的文字***
~~这是加删除线的文字~~
#三、图片
![blockchain](https://ss0.bdstatic.com/70cFvHSh_Q1YnxGkpoWK1HF6hhy/it/
u=702257389,1274025419&fm=27&gp=0.jpg "区块链")
#四、超链接
[简书](http://jianshu.com)
[百度](http://baidu.com)
# 五、代码
def publish_article(request):
if request.method == 'POST':
pass
article_form = ArticleForm()
return render(request, 'publish_article.html', locals())
view里使用:
article.content = markdown(article.content, extensions=['markdown.extensions.extra', 'markdown.extensions.codehilite',])
在css文件夹下运行,生成代码颜色样式,在html导入
pygmentize -S monokai -f html -a .codehilite > monokai.css